Commit Graph

  • 74fff81da4 dahdi: Remove interruptible_sleep_on() calls for WINK/FLASH. Shaun Ruffell 2010-12-21 16:09:17 +00:00
  • 492315c255 wcb4xxp: Remove unused syncpos member. Shaun Ruffell 2010-12-20 19:49:05 +00:00
  • 34400ad07c wcte12xp, wctdm24xxp: Use more descriptive symbols for the bus setup. Shaun Ruffell 2010-12-15 18:54:53 +00:00
  • 4de462c3e0 wctdm24xxp, wcte12xp: Disable PCI read-line multiple command. Shaun Ruffell 2010-12-15 18:54:49 +00:00
  • 1d9cbea469 wcb4xxp: Remove redundant dev member from 'struct wcb4xxp' Shaun Ruffell 2010-12-15 17:53:35 +00:00
  • eba7fe3ca4 wct4xxp: Close a memory leak in the VPM450 error path. Shaun Ruffell 2010-12-15 17:53:31 +00:00
  • b7cf1d9c02 vpmadt032: Convert ifacelock from rwlock to plain spinlock. Shaun Ruffell 2010-12-15 17:53:25 +00:00
  • 9292e6f0ad wctc4xxp: Make the "mode" module parameter read-only in sysfs. Shaun Ruffell 2010-12-15 17:53:21 +00:00
  • 0c3cbc2c32 wcte12xp: Unregister the span before any additional cleanup. Shaun Ruffell 2010-12-15 17:53:16 +00:00
  • 5b6fba6e4b wctdm24xxp, wcte12xp: Lock interrupts when recovering from an underrun. Shaun Ruffell 2010-12-15 17:53:12 +00:00
  • cf3e4bd757 wctdm24xxp, wcte12xp: Add more descriptive message on a failed reset. Shaun Ruffell 2010-12-15 17:53:07 +00:00
  • af9a089714 live_dahdi: Fix regression from r9508 Tzafrir Cohen 2010-12-13 15:56:16 +00:00
  • 3203aaf84c dahdi: Do not dereference chan->span for pseudo channels. Shaun Ruffell 2010-12-13 14:57:12 +00:00
  • 249baf1db3 README, UPGRADE.txt, system.conf.sample: Add documentation for using HWEC Kinsey Moore 2010-12-09 22:44:52 +00:00
  • 60c4681ec8 dahdi_echocan_hpec: Update the HPEC wrapper to use the new name interface Kinsey Moore 2010-12-09 21:52:34 +00:00
  • 7a7d4000a0 dahdi-base, dahdi_echocan_*, wcb4xxp, wct4xxp, wctdm24xxp, wcte12xp, kernel: Allow name of EC factory to vary based on channel Kinsey Moore 2010-12-09 20:19:26 +00:00
  • fd01eef199 dahdi-base, kernel, dahdi_echocan_*, wcb4xxp, wct4xxp, wctdm24xxp, wcte12xp: Remove name field from echocan ops Kinsey Moore 2010-12-09 20:19:21 +00:00
  • 06eac5b1d2 dahdi-base: Alarms may not be the last item on the line, so don't strip the trailing space Kinsey Moore 2010-12-09 20:19:18 +00:00
  • fbee540bf5 dahdi-base: Remove old method of invoking HWEC Kinsey Moore 2010-12-09 20:19:16 +00:00
  • 6140d43665 dahdi-base: Allow HWEC to use the modular echocan interface Kinsey Moore 2010-12-09 20:19:13 +00:00
  • d3d246b656 dahdi_maint: Added the loopup/loopdown functionality Russ Meyerriecks 2010-12-08 22:14:29 +00:00
  • 6e25ac61db dahdi: Fixed loopup/loopdown signals Russ Meyerriecks 2010-12-08 22:11:58 +00:00
  • bbdcb0c7ba dahdi: Removing loopstop maint function Russ Meyerriecks 2010-12-08 22:11:53 +00:00
  • 5ee55a6147 dahdi: Clean up an unused waitqueue Russ Meyerriecks 2010-12-08 22:11:46 +00:00
  • 51bff0d802 wcte12xp: Use interruptible waits to decrease impact on load average. Shaun Ruffell 2010-12-08 01:56:56 +00:00
  • f7925643de dahdi: Prevent unloadable module on failed open. Shaun Ruffell 2010-12-07 14:20:38 +00:00
  • 8b43a66913 live_dahdi: fix usage of xpp.conf Tzafrir Cohen 2010-12-07 12:00:28 +00:00
  • 87d376ba19 xpd_pri: Remove pointless hooksig span op Tzafrir Cohen 2010-12-07 11:00:07 +00:00
  • 1b79cc7562 xpd_pri: ignore DAHDI_VMWI and DAHDIVMWI_CONFIG Tzafrir Cohen 2010-12-07 10:59:37 +00:00
  • 2175ea1293 wctdm24xxp, wcte12xp: Close a few potential resource assignment leaks. Shaun Ruffell 2010-12-02 22:42:56 +00:00
  • 102a2f0982 wctdm24xxp: Replace interruptible_sleep_on() with msleep when delaying. Shaun Ruffell 2010-12-01 16:59:20 +00:00
  • 3f57781f6e Add 'install-tests' Makefile target. Jason Parker 2010-11-29 17:53:50 +00:00
  • 75c33ce64e dahdi: A little cleanup in the dahdi_ioctl_iomux function. Shaun Ruffell 2010-11-25 00:07:10 +00:00
  • f406bba4c6 dahdi: dahdi_ioctl_iomux should return 0 on success. Sean Bright 2010-11-25 00:07:05 +00:00
  • 08d3ff5671 dahdi: Fixup prior dahdi_mirror patch Russ Meyerriecks 2010-11-19 17:34:42 +00:00
  • 494472ee1a dahdi: Stops junk data from overwriting the dahdi_mirror pseudo chans Russ Meyerriecks 2010-11-19 17:34:36 +00:00
  • 712704c237 dahdi: Moved the channel mirroring interface behind a build flag Russ Meyerriecks 2010-11-19 17:34:31 +00:00
  • 9090c6fcd2 dahdi: adding ss7 pcap support to dahdi. Russ Meyerriecks 2010-11-19 17:34:25 +00:00
  • 06136006df dahdi: In dahdi_unregister() 'new_master' should not be static. Shaun Ruffell 2010-11-19 14:07:29 +00:00
  • 1e2923566d dahdi-base: Add debug option to log RBS bit changes Russ Meyerriecks 2010-11-18 17:15:07 +00:00
  • 88035ea78c dahdi_genconf: Don't generate configurations that use channel 16 on E1 CAS Kinsey Moore 2010-11-17 15:32:52 +00:00
  • e38b85fde9 xpp_fxloader: Don't try to load FPGA firmware twice Tzafrir Cohen 2010-11-16 10:56:54 +00:00
  • 76f35e5d31 live_dahdi: rsync to /tmp/dahdi Tzafrir Cohen 2010-11-15 14:56:32 +00:00
  • daa79cc634 live_dahdi: only check for TOOLS_DIR when used Tzafrir Cohen 2010-11-15 14:53:24 +00:00
  • 55a9fd2da2 dahdi_maint: Minor name change for the error counters Russ Meyerriecks 2010-11-11 22:32:27 +00:00
  • d013943b4b make_version: Use 'git rev-parse' if only looking for a sha5. Shaun Ruffell 2010-11-11 19:32:58 +00:00
  • 393aef02ef dahdi_scan: Show CAS framing on the framing line. Shaun Ruffell 2010-11-10 16:19:36 +00:00
  • 8c24b0fd8f wctdm24xxp: 'wait_just_a_bit()' -> 'msleep()' Shaun Ruffell 2010-11-04 16:41:02 +00:00
  • c674c147fd wctdm24xxp: Remove unused 'usecount' member. Shaun Ruffell 2010-11-04 16:40:58 +00:00
  • 4deae0c8ea wctdm24xxp: Replace 'schluffen()' with 'interruptible_sleep_on()' Shaun Ruffell 2010-11-04 16:40:53 +00:00
  • 3de1002cb5 dahdi: Constify the dahdi_txlevelnames and return of dahdi_lboname(). Shaun Ruffell 2010-11-04 16:40:49 +00:00
  • a170389509 dahdi: Close race between checking IOMUX condition and sleeping. Shaun Ruffell 2010-11-04 16:40:44 +00:00
  • 649fa2f43d dahdi: Move the DAHDI_IOMUX ioctl handler into a separate function. Shaun Ruffell 2010-11-04 16:40:40 +00:00
  • a782b4de71 dahdi: 'schluffen()' -> 'interruptible_sleep_on()' or 'wait_event_interruptible()' Shaun Ruffell 2010-11-04 16:40:35 +00:00
  • 37097411ea Remove mutex emulation Shaun Ruffell 2010-11-04 16:40:29 +00:00
  • 3f9cb05bae dahdi: Remove DAHDI_CONFLINK functionality. Shaun Ruffell 2010-11-04 16:40:23 +00:00
  • 1b51530c19 Minor logging text change Russ Meyerriecks 2010-10-25 20:01:54 +00:00
  • 3140dfc482 Fixed up the loss of crc4-multiframe alignment logic Russ Meyerriecks 2010-10-25 18:58:17 +00:00
  • 3db405486e dahdi: Eliminate NULL dereference when bridging channels. Shaun Ruffell 2010-10-25 18:26:27 +00:00
  • cba1734e18 wctdm24xxp: Detect FXS modules based on the 3210 SLIC. Shaun Ruffell 2010-10-25 18:26:17 +00:00
  • a3ae25141a Dahdi::Hardware: Support beroNet BN4S0e PCI Express card Tzafrir Cohen 2010-10-20 18:02:35 +00:00
  • d9cdda31aa wcb4xxp: Support beroNet BN4S0e PCI Express card Tzafrir Cohen 2010-10-20 17:52:47 +00:00
  • 27899f256c dahdi-base: Fixed null pointer dereference in dahdi_check_conf Kinsey Moore 2010-10-20 16:20:30 +00:00
  • 92e2a646eb dahdi: Remove CONFIG_OLD_HDLC_API since that is kernel 2.4 specific. Shaun Ruffell 2010-10-20 12:23:28 +00:00
  • 15182a4a18 wctdm24xxp, wcte12xp: Remove unused 'whichframe' parameter. Shaun Ruffell 2010-10-20 12:23:26 +00:00
  • 53d674dc21 dahdi: Drop some 'zt' prefixes on chan. Shaun Ruffell 2010-10-20 12:23:23 +00:00
  • aa5c973611 dahdi: Atomically set/test if channel has associated network device. Shaun Ruffell 2010-10-20 12:23:16 +00:00
  • 072ccc9b69 dahdi_echocan_oslec: Call olsec_hpf_tx if CONFIG_DAHDI_PROCESS_ECHOCAN_TX is defined. Shaun Ruffell 2010-10-20 12:23:11 +00:00
  • 2ba1b4c201 dahdi: Add compile time DAHDI_ECHOCAN_PROCESS_TX option. Shaun Ruffell 2010-10-20 12:23:06 +00:00
  • 5b08a20526 wctdm24xxp: Leave FXO (DAA) always in full-wave ring detect mode. Shaun Ruffell 2010-10-20 12:23:02 +00:00
  • 141a61d64e wctc4xxp: Space required after ','. Shaun Ruffell 2010-10-20 12:22:59 +00:00
  • 9dc983cc0d wctc4xxp: Remove trailing whitespace. Shaun Ruffell 2010-10-20 12:22:57 +00:00
  • 615c6b6800 wctc4xxp: Cannot print the encoder/decoder channels before we know them. Shaun Ruffell 2010-10-20 12:22:54 +00:00
  • 8d29ecb783 wctc4xxp: 'WARN_ON(1)' -> 'dev_info(...' on channel creation failure. Shaun Ruffell 2010-10-20 12:22:52 +00:00
  • b4170d8f40 wctc4xxp: Drop 'DTE_PRINTK' macro in favor of standard 'dev_xxx' Shaun Ruffell 2010-10-20 12:22:49 +00:00
  • 8ac8b90bd4 wctc4xxp: Remove 'service_dte' function and a few inline keywords. Shaun Ruffell 2010-10-20 12:22:47 +00:00
  • 8897a79f5b dahdi: '-o' -> '--no-same-owner' in drivers/dahdi/firmware/Makefile Shaun Ruffell 2010-10-20 12:22:42 +00:00
  • f5f0958381 dahdi: dahdi_chan_unreg was not cleaning up conferenced channels properly. Shaun Ruffell 2010-10-20 12:22:39 +00:00
  • a8b1e2b662 vpmadt032: Honor the CONFIG_DAHDI_NO_ECHOCAN_DISABLE flag. Shaun Ruffell 2010-10-20 12:22:35 +00:00
  • 53b658db1b xpp: Fixes init error for PRI devices with < 4 ports Tzafrir Cohen 2010-10-18 14:50:03 +00:00
  • 6646cba099 Ignore oct612x generated files in SVN Tzafrir Cohen 2010-10-18 13:37:57 +00:00
  • 81205b90f7 astribank_is_starting: use semop if no semtimedop Tzafrir Cohen 2010-10-17 18:41:24 +00:00
  • c4ae51ffae dahdi: 'if (chan)' -> 'if (!chan)' in dahdi_ioctl_getgains. Shaun Ruffell 2010-10-04 17:20:47 +00:00
  • 408787c77b dahdi: Anonymous member in dahdi_echocan_events union. Kinsey Moore 2010-09-29 22:00:22 +00:00
  • b0185d1e84 dahdi: Fix 'void *' pointer arithmetic warnings. Kinsey Moore 2010-09-29 21:32:55 +00:00
  • d802a2738d make_version: svn and git metadata directory not checked properly. Kinsey Moore 2010-09-29 21:21:45 +00:00
  • 3400734174 wcb4xxp: Spelling 'LOOKBACK_SUPPORTED' -> 'LOOPBACK_SUPPORTED' Shaun Ruffell 2010-09-27 15:57:13 +00:00
  • 1c462653e7 dahdi: Remove bigzaplock by converting chan_lock to spinlock_t. Shaun Ruffell 2010-09-24 22:45:07 +00:00
  • c3ae5634d7 dahdi: process_timers is already called with interrupts disabled. Shaun Ruffell 2010-09-24 22:45:03 +00:00
  • 87336d22fc dahdi: Rename 'zaptimer' -> 'dahdi_timer' Shaun Ruffell 2010-09-24 22:44:59 +00:00
  • 283235686d Move test for DEFINE_SPINLOCK into include/dahdi/kernel.h Shaun Ruffell 2010-09-24 22:44:53 +00:00
  • 41825e7c32 dahdi: Remove remaining #if 0 locations from dahdi-base. Shaun Ruffell 2010-09-24 22:44:49 +00:00
  • 7a83fe8e19 dahdi: Add '+' on KMAKE definition to enable parallel make. Shaun Ruffell 2010-09-24 22:44:45 +00:00
  • 7872d47517 make_version: '[[' -> '[' since it's not a bash script. Shaun Ruffell 2010-09-24 22:44:41 +00:00
  • 731b5868d4 dahdi: Allow core DAHDI software timing to work when DAHDI_CHUNKSIZE > 8. Shaun Ruffell 2010-09-24 22:44:37 +00:00
  • d08cdac785 dahdi: Only disable/enable interrupts once when iterating through channels. Shaun Ruffell 2010-09-24 22:44:30 +00:00
  • 6d807c7dfc dahdi: trivial spelling 'implemnted' -> 'implemented' Shaun Ruffell 2010-09-23 21:39:02 +00:00
  • 6d602c96b9 dahdi_dynamic: Update copyright. Shaun Ruffell 2010-09-23 21:38:57 +00:00
  • 5618e9e812 wcte12xp, wctdm24xxp: Convert vbb cache from kmem_cache to dma_pool. Shaun Ruffell 2010-09-23 21:38:52 +00:00
  • 9038e0a2cd wcte12xp, wctdm24xxp: Remove comment about converting from IO space. Shaun Ruffell 2010-09-23 21:38:48 +00:00